Description These photographs were taken for the 1939-1940 edition of the Uintah High School Yearbook and are located on page 86. First row, top left corner is of the students in front of the High School. It's titled, "Utes". First row, center: eight unidentified girls. One is being helped into a hand stand. First row, right: unidentified boy (perhaps Garth J. Atwood?), unidentified girl, unidentified boy. Second row, left: unidentified man. There is an automobile in the background. The photo is titled: "Well-loved Prof." Second row, center: unidentified students. The photo is titled: "Back at U.H.S." Second row, right: unidentified girl, unidentified girl, unidentified boy, unidentified boy. The photo is titled: "Production of What?" Third row, left: unidentified students. Six of the ten are mid-jump. There is an automobile in the background. The photo is titled: "Action-And How". Third row, center: unidentified girl studying. Third row, right: eight unidentified girls. There are six girls at the back and two in the front.
